C# 如何删除<;img>;标记是否未从数据库提交任何文件路径
我有一个显示文章的转发器,在那里可以或不能提交图片 它工作得很好,但是当没有插入图片时,C# 如何删除<;img>;标记是否未从数据库提交任何文件路径,c#,asp.net,C#,Asp.net,我有一个显示文章的转发器,在那里可以或不能提交图片 它工作得很好,但是当没有插入图片时,alt文本仍会显示,但显然没有图片 <article class="newsPic"> <img src="<%# Eval("picFilePath") %>" width="100%" alt="News Picture"/> </article> “width=“100%”alt=“新闻图片”/> 如果没有提交文件路径,如果字段
alt
文本仍会显示,但显然没有图片
<article class="newsPic">
<img src="<%# Eval("picFilePath") %>" width="100%" alt="News Picture"/>
</article>
“width=“100%”alt=“新闻图片”/>
如果没有提交文件路径,如果字段为空,如何删除控件
我发现了这个,但目前我看不出如何在它周围包装一个
标签:
<asp:Label ID="MailingAddress" runat="server"
Text='<%# Eval("MailingAddress") %>'
Visible='<%# !string.IsNullOrEmpty(Eval("MailingAddress") as string) %>'/>
你刚刚给了自己一个答案:)
'style=“width:100%”alt=“新闻图片”
runat=“server”可见=“”/>
你刚刚给了自己一个答案:)
'style=“width:100%”alt=“新闻图片”
runat=“server”可见=“”/>
将其包装在一个标记中让我完全不知所措。但由于某些原因,alt文本仍然会显示..?别忘了runat=“server”?谢谢大家,但现在:服务器标记的格式不太好:-(在src周围使用单引号而不是双引号抱歉,时间太晚了,我有点累了。谢谢@mr.freeze。将它包装在一个标记中让我彻底崩溃了。尽管出于某种原因,alt文本仍然显示…?别忘了runat=“server”?谢谢大家,但现在:服务器标记的格式不太好-(在src中使用单引号而不是双引号对不起,时间不早了,我有点累了。谢谢@mr.freeze。
<img src='<%# Eval("picFilePath") %>' style="width:100%" alt="News Picture"
runat="server" visible='<%# !string.IsNullOrEmpty(Eval("picFilePath") as string) %>' />